In 1884, Jewish refugee Michael Marks set up a stall at an open market in Leeds. The stall's signage read "Don't ask for the price - it's a penny". Marks invited Thomas Spencer to become a partner after the business had been successful. Spencer contributed 300 pounds, and his skills in management and accounting complemented Marks flair for selling and distributing merchandise.
M&S's early stores were designed to adapt to changing social needs. Improving living standards allowed families to shop for more, and Marks changed by introducing open displays and encouraging browsing and self-selection. In the course of time, the company grew rapidly. In 1915, the company had 145 stores.
In the 1960s, M&S started to develop its own brand of products. This included the introductions of synthetic fibres such as Tricell and Coutelle and machine washable knitwear. Lingerie was given a fashion 'edge' in the 1980s, with co-ordinated sets based on catwalk trends.
M&S is committed to reducing its environmental footprint. It has developed a 100-point plan that affects every aspect of its business, from heating in the store to the labels on products. The goal of the plan is to cut down on emissions, encourage healthy eating, develop fair partnerships and use sustainable raw materials.

H&M
In 1947, the company was founded. Hennes & Mauritz AB is the second-largest retailer of fashion in the world. Its success is based on speedy fashion, which involves identifying trends as they arise and putting low-cost copies into stores as quickly as is possible. H&M is different from other retailers that take months to create and create new styles, H&M can put together collections in just two weeks. This is the reason H&M stores are always stocked with new clothes.
